CHEVROLET CAPTIVA (2007-12) 5DR SUV 4WD 2.0 CDI 148 LT 7 SEAT

The CHEVROLET CAPTIVA (2007-12) 5DR SUV 4WD 2.0 CDI 148 LT 7 SEAT is a versatile and spacious vehicle designed to meet the needs of families and outdoor enthusiasts alike. As a mid-size SUV, it offers a commanding driving position, generous interior space, and seating for up to seven passengers, making it an excellent choice for those who prioritize practicality without sacrificing comfort. This model is popular among drivers who require a reliable family car or a vehicle capable of handling a variety of terrains, thanks to its four-wheel-drive capability. What makes the CHEVROLET CAPTIVA stand out in its class is its blend of rugged style, decent fuel economy for a vehicle of its size, and user-friendly features. It’s known for offering good value in the used car market, with an average valuation of around £1,400 according to MyCarCheck.com data, and it has seen a steady number of genuine used car inquiries, reflecting its reliability and appeal. Compared to competitors, the CHEVROLET CAPTIVA is recognized for its spaciousness and practicality, making it an appealing choice for families, first-time buyers, or anyone seeking an affordable, multi-purpose SUV in the UK.

The data indicates that the majority of private sale prices for the 2007-2012 Chevrolet Captiva 5DR SUV 4WD 2.0 CDI 148 LT 7 Seat are clustered below £2,000, with 34.4% of vehicles selling for between £0 and £1,000, and 45.2% for between £1,000 and £2,000. Only a smaller proportion, 20.4%, fetches prices between £2,000 and £3,000. This suggests that, in the private sale market, most of these vehicles are valued quite affordably, likely reflecting factors such as vehicle age, condition, or market demand for this model.

The data indicates that the majority of Chevrolet Captiva (2007-12) 5-door SUVs with a 2.0 CDI engine are manufactured in 2008, accounting for 71% of the sample. Vehicles from 2007 make up around 20.4%, while those from 2009 comprise about 8.6%. This suggests that the 2008 model is the most common within this range, likely reflecting the production years most prevalent or available in the UK market.
